      Simplify QA commands · 2f4b4f78
      Iustin Pop authored
      
      Currently, 95% of the QA commands are executed in the same way: on the
      master, based on a command list and with expectancies for succes:
      
          AssertEqual(StartSSH(master['primary'],
                               utils.ShellQuoteArgs(cmd)).wait(), 0)
      
      The rest 5% are variations on this theme (maybe the command needs to
      fail, or the node is different, etc.). Based on this, we can simplify
      the code significantly if we abstract the common theme into a new
      AssertCommand() function. This saves ~250 lines of code in the QA suite,
      around 8% of the entire QA code size.
      
      Additionally, the output was very cryptic before (the famous "QA error:
      1 != 0" messages), whereas now we show a clear error message (node,
      command, exit code and failure mode).
      
      The patch replaces single quotes with double quotes in all the parts of
      the code that I touch; let me know if that's not OK…
